Responsibilities
- Assist the Chief Engineer in supervising engine room operations on offshore vessels and ensuring reliable performance of propulsion and auxiliary systems
- Plan and perform preventive maintenance, inspections, and repairs for marine diesel engines, generators, boilers, pumps, and associated gear
- Monitor engine room data, diagnose faults, carry out troubleshooting, and coordinate repairs with crew and shore support
- Support and participate in DP vessel operations as required, including dynamic positioning monitoring and safety procedures during station keeping
- Maintain detailed logs, maintenance reports, fuel and lube oil consumption records, and inventory of spare parts
- Ensure compliance with SOLAS, MARPOL, ISM, flag state regulations, and company safety policies; promote safe work practices
- Assist in on board drills and safety training, fostering a culture of safety and welfare on board
Qualifications
- Valid Philippines 2nd Engineer license II/2 and DP Vessel Management certification or equivalent recognized by flag state
- Minimum 2 to 5 years of hands on experience as a 2nd Engineer on offshore vessels; DP class experience preferred
- STCW Basic Safety Training and offshore safety certifications; valid medical certificate
- Strong knowledge of marine diesel engines, propulsion plants, electrical systems, and automation
- Proficient in reading P and IDs, mechanical drawings, and maintenance planning software
- Excellent problem solving, communication, and teamwork skills; able to work under pressure and long assignments
- Willingness to travel worldwide, work flexible schedules, and comply with safety and regulatory requirements
